This allows you to setup aliases, which are of the form charset, for example. Now i have read that libxml2 can use iconv to convert to the correct utf8 encoding, i see that iconv not is present and was wondering where i could download the source, so i could cross compile it. Utf 16 is used in major operating systems and environments, like microsoft windows, java and. With this change, users and developers of fedora will get unicode 7.
The first part of the locale name stands for the language, the second for the country or dialect, and the third for the character encoding. The buffer size of 10 is insufficient to store the utf8 string. This downgrade should not have stopped you from launching gnometerminal, please file a bug against gnometerminal, they should fall back to try c. Addons disabled or fail to install on firefox how to fix the failed addons problem from may 2019. It is a way to get good iconv support without having glibc 2. In order to save disk space and memory, as well as to make upgrading easier, common system code is kept in one place and shared between programs. Utf8 locale to our glibc packages fedora mailinglists.
Utf 8 in their definitions, at least that is what all articles claim. For more information on characters sets, see charsets7 and. Hi, how can i find out the charset on a unix server sunos 5. Programming guidelines odbc driver sql server microsoft. The roger leigh link you posted in a comment i believe refers to using an expanded set utf 8 as the c locale in a c library destined for an embedded environment, so that no other locale has to be loaded for the system to deal with utf 8. The unicode and iso 10646 standards even specify such an encoding. Thus, in the vast or the root account when install postgresql using aptget. Compiling it myself is beyond the time i have available. If its a two byte utf8 character, then its always of form 110xxxxx10xxxxxx. For these reasons, you can store a utf 8 string in a stdstring. Community packages opened by mark mmm sunday, 04 november 2012, 19. With this tool you can easily find all errors in utf8encoded text. In other words, it is a tool that converts base64 to original data. I have tried the glibc source, but this has no luck for me yet.
No matter which desktop environment you are using, it may be necessary to log out and, if you are using a login manager e. This encoding is able to represent all of iso 10646 31 bits in a byte string of length one to six. Utf8, not utf8 or utf8 in locale setting to have scim working. This prevents passing filenames as arguments if the filenames contain characters that fall outside of this codepage. Unicode utf 8 free download,unicode utf 8 software collection download. Utf 8 is the preferred encoding for email and web pages. Utf 8 is a standard transformation format for unicode characters and it is ideal character repertoire for any platform or language anywhere in the world. After modifying a locale, make sure it compiles, and install it to a temporary directory. The name is derived from unicode or universal coded character set transformation. If this is out of the question then you should store your string in utf 8 in your code. Unicode utf8 free download,unicode utf8 software collection download. The specs and linker cannot be adjusted before the glibc install because the glibc.
However, applications that use a non utf 8 encoding in the above list via setlocale need to use that encoding for data tofrom the driver instead of utf 8. Kdm or gdm, restart the x window system by pressing ctrlaltbackspace so that etcprofile is reread and all applications come to know. There were a few other attempts to encode iso 10646. The specs and linker cannot be adjusted before the glibc install because the glibc autoconf tests would give false results and defeat the goal of achieving a clean build. Thus, in a typical linux or macos environment where the encoding is utf8, users of odbc driver 17 upgrading from or. Download utf 8 converter smallsized and portable application that converts plain text documents to utf 8 unicode format immediately and with minimum effort. Encounters a website using some character set, usually utf8, utf16 or iso 88591. Your viewer might need to be told that the files are utf8 for them to show properly. It is also used in many places, and thus one can often avoid conversions. What would break if the c locale was utf8 instead of ascii. Utf8 is a multibyte encoding which uses between 1 and 4 bytes per character. It is preferable to edit your locale in utf 8 and then use localeescape to encode your work in the format used in glibc locale files.
I have not found the ultimate backing proof for that statement. Currently a1 website download does the following when scanning. Given a position p with a utf8 encoded string str, find the start of the previous utf8 character starting before p. Your viewer might need to be told that the files are utf 8 for them to show properly. And thanks for the link to the one already compiled. This works for me in printf cannot test here with glib. The gnu c library is the standard system c library for all gnu systems, and is an important part of what makes up a gnu system. The base64 decode online is a free decoder for decoding online base64 to text or binary. Thus, in a typical linux or macos environment where the encoding is utf 8, users of odbc driver 17 upgrading from or. A similar process should work on 32bit amahi installs.
The name is derived from unicode or universal coded. Total removed characters in newly generated charmap. Mark as xfail malloctstmxfast and nptltstmutex10 to fix riscv64 ftbfs. I suspect that this is due to glibc generating these files when other components are present in the build environment, however, since we dont care about infolocale files, ive just dropped them from the %files list. Utf8 8bit unicode transformation format is a variable width character encoding capable of encoding all 1,112,064 valid character code points in unicode using one to four onebyte 8bit code units. Refresh firefox reset addons and settings a refresh can fix many issues by restoring firefox to its default state while saving essential information like bookmarks and passwords. If toraw false the default, the value is a character vector of the same length and the same attributes as x after conversion to a character vector if mark true the default the elements of the result have a declared encoding if to is latin1 or utf 8, or if to and the current locales encoding is detected as latin1 or its superset cp1252 on windows or utf 8. Utf8vcl allows your delphi application to become a unicode applications with no changes to your vcl code and third party components. For size reasons, were unlikely to include much internationalization support beyond utf8, and on top of all that, our configuration menu lets developers chop out features to produce smaller but very nonstandard utilities. Youll note that it deals with surrogates for the utf16 conversion but not for the wide character conversion. Configuring glibc the etcnf file needs to be created because, although glibc provides defaults when this file is missing or corrupt, the glibc defaults do not work well in a networked environment. If i send an xml file with encoding utf 8, should the server be able to handle the file, even with special characters in it. A simple, portable and lightweight generic library for handling utf 8 encoded strings.
Returns null if no utf8 characters are present in str before p. However, applications that use a nonutf8 encoding in the above list via setlocale need to use that encoding for. It looks strange to me that something as basic as glibc cannot come already compiled for arm considering alpine is a good fit for that. If your file is not automatically highlighted then you will need to download the file and follow these instructions. But for compatibility, oldfashioned 7bit ascii strings are unchanged when encoded as utf 8, and utf 8 strings do not contain null bytes which would cause old code to misjudge the number of bytes. It is preferable to edit your locale in utf8 and then use localeescape to encode your work in the format used in glibc locale files. Returns null if no utf 8 characters are present in str before p. I managed to make it work and thought id share how for those interested. Utf 8 8 bit unicode transformation format is a variable width character encoding capable of encoding all 1,112,064 valid code points in unicode using one to four 8 bit bytes. This directory contains the sources of the gnu c library. Running windows as administrator with launcher process enabled. Tonido does not support fedora nor is there a 64bit version. Try printing this one its the hexadecimal representation of your string. A simple, portable and lightweight generic library for handling utf8 encoded strings.
The glibc package contains standard libraries which are used by multiple programs on the system. Utf8 is usually a good choice because it efficiently encodes ascii data too, and the character data i typically deal with still has a high percentage of ascii chars. Its superpower is the ability to automatically detect the encoding standard. By joining our community you will have the ability to post topics, receive our newsletter, use the advanced search, subscribe to threads and access many other special features. Dears, i have a shell script working perfectly on oracle linux that detects the encoding the charset to be exact of the files in a specified directory using the file command the file command outputs the charset in linux, but doesnt do that in aix, then if the file isnt a utf8 text. The reason is probably that dnf with allowerasing managed to remove your glibc langpacks or downgrade them to the minimal language pack e. The glibc build system is selfcontained and will install perfectly, even though the compiler specs file and linker are still pointing at tools. There are differences between centosrhel 7 and the new version 8. The 32bit version has been packaged for amahi and currently in alpha status. There is a file i18n in i18nlocales folder, so i was just thinking about that file. Nov 02, 2004 gnome seems to always use utf 8 internally, even if the locale is not utf 8 based. Given a position p with a utf 8 encoded string str, find the start of the previous utf 8 character starting before p. Utf8 is a standard transformation format for unicode characters and it is ideal character repertoire for.
If i send an xml file with encodingutf8, should the server be able to handle the file, even with special characters in it. Presuming the system is utf8, those strings will look correct when used by the resulting executable. Normally, on windows, the command line arguments are passed to main in the system codepage encoding. If its a single byte utf8 character, then it is always of form 0xxxxxxx, where x is any binary digit. No check is made to see if the character found is actually valid other than it starts with an. Using the above procedure, we managed to fix the failed to set locale, defaulting to c. The encoding is defined by the unicode standard, and was originally designed by ken thompson and rob pike. So, it is safer to use 40 as the buffer size above. Utf8 file is an unicode utf8 encoded text document. The roger leigh link you posted in a comment i believe refers to using an expanded set utf8 as the c locale in a c library destined for an embedded environment, so that no other locale has to be loaded for the system to deal with utf8. The website text is converted into the local computer windows configured codepage.
458 363 1524 875 1224 147 392 982 332 1597 370 147 695 135 1300 276 83 234 699 1305 795 773 1127 945 1039 1031 1236 733 141 1260 1247 1225 394 107 317 1237 1352 1277 656 532 480